  • Maurie Plant Meet Recap with Men's 800m Winner Luke Boyes
    Mar 31 2026

    Joel and Riley are joined by newly crowned men’s 800m champion Luke Boyes to break down the standout moments from Saturday night (at least from a distance running perspective!!!).

    Before unpacking the evening through the FTK lens, they chat with Luke about his race-winning performance, look ahead to the Australian Championships, and discuss how it all shapes his upcoming European season. At just 22, Luke brings a grounded mix of maturity and humility to the conversation as he reflects on his journey in the sport.
